Публикации по теме 'java'
Использование аннотаций @PathVariable и @RequestParam в Spring MVC
Введение
Если вы работаете со Spring MVC, вы, вероятно, часто будете иметь дело с HTTP-запросами. При обработке этих запросов вам может потребоваться извлечь определенные параметры либо из URL-адреса, либо из параметров запроса. Здесь в игру вступают две мощные аннотации, предоставляемые Spring MVC, @PathVariable и @RequestParam .
Обзор
Прежде чем углубиться, давайте обрисуем в общих чертах, что это за аннотации:
@PathVariable — это аннотация Spring, указывающая, что..
10 лучших курсов Spring для изучения Spring Framework
Изучите платформу Spring для разработки веб-приложений с помощью лучших весенних курсов.
Spring — это корпоративная среда Java, которая делает разработку Java EE более простой и продуктивной. Он продвигает хорошие методы кодирования и ускоряет разработку программного обеспечения за счет использования инверсии управления и внедрения зависимостей. Spring Framework — это выбор для тех, кто хочет разрабатывать надежные веб-API, расширять свои знания Java и приобретать навыки, необходимые..
.equals() против ==
Не так давно в своей карьере я тоже выучил наизусть версию самой старой мантры из книги для интервью разработчиков Java.
Что-то вроде:
== сравнивает ссылки на объекты, а .equals() сравнивает все, что определено в переопределенном методе класса, для которого он вызывается.
Если переопределение не указано, по умолчанию используется Object.equals() .
Такие посты, как этот и тот , придавали некоторую уверенность в том, что я говорил.
Несколько лет спустя, когда я готовился к..
Раскрытие возможностей Java: путешествие по классам
В Java класс — это план создания объектов, которые имеют общие свойства и поведение. Он определяет атрибуты и методы, которые будут иметь объекты этого класса.
Вот пример класса в Java:
public class Car {
private String make;
private String model;
private int year;
public Car(String make, String model, int year) {
this.make = make;
this.model = model;
this.year = year;
}
public String getMake() {
return make;
}..
Доступное обучение Java
Подготовка к программированию в Лучшем институте обучения Java в Ченнаи — наиболее востребованная способность для большинства организаций. Учебные классы по Java стали популярными для улучшения и повышения наших способностей. Учебный план курса включает основы Java, объекты Java, сервлеты, JSP, наборы данных, ООП, коллекции Java, отражение Java, перечисления Java, Java Beans, безопасность Java, JMS и фильтры сервлетов.
Изучите организацию по подготовке Java-технологий — лучшую..
Python vs Java: что и где использовать
Python и Java уже давно борются за лидирующие позиции среди самых популярных языков программирования.
Python в последнее время приобрел большую популярность. По версии Insights Stackoverflow за 2019 год Python занимает первое место в рейтинге самых востребованных языков программирования. И, согласно Индексу TIOBE , Python - самый быстрорастущий язык. Пока Java прочно стоит на ногах благодаря своей стабильности, точности, масштабируемости, а также большим проектам, уже..
Изучение быстрой сортировки
В этой статье на примере подробно рассматривается Java-реализация QuickSort. Статья написана для меня как целевой аудитории для самостоятельного изучения, поэтому новичкам в QuickSort может быть немного сложно понять сначала, но она может дать некоторое представление о том, как работает QuickSort.
Вероятно, будет полезно скопировать код в вашу IDE и выполнять отладку кода во время чтения. public void sort(int[] array){
sort(array,0,array.length-1);
}
private void sort..